Hawks Nest State Park - Country Roads Festival

Two day festival with craft vendors, food vendors and live entertainment. Entertainment on Saturday will include traditional music, high school band, lip syncs, blue-grass and rock bands. Sunday entertainment will feature gospel music. Free Event. Sponsored by the Ansted Lions Club.

BPW Arts and Crafts Fair

27th annual event.
Nearly 100 exhibitors with handcrafted treasures such as wood work, metal work, primitives, floral, paintings, candles, needle-crafts, ceramics, jewelry, and much more, including cash and door prizes, and food vendors.
Admission and parking are free.
